What is the name of Moya's airport?
Book a flight to Moya and you'll be hitting the tarmac at Gran Canaria Airport (LPA).
How far is LPA from central Moya?
The trip from Gran Canaria Airport (LPA) to downtown Moya is reasonably long. You'll have to travel 27 kilometres before you can drop your bags at your hotel in the city.
What airport is best to fly into Moya?
Las Palmas Airport is the only major airport in Moya. Before you fly, it's a wise idea to know a little about it. The terminal sits about 27 kilometres from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Moya?
There are a total of 44 airlines connecting Moya with 122 airports from all over the globe.
Which airlines fly to Moya?
Binter Canarias and Canaryfly operate the majority of flights to Moya. One of the most preferred ways to travel there is with a Binter Canarias flight from Santa Cruz de Tenerife.
How many nonstop flights are there to Moya?
With roughly 1,225 direct flights every week, you'll be arriving in Moya before you have time to say, "Are we there yet?"
Where are the most popular flights to Moya departing from?
A large number of flights to Moya depart from Santa Cruz de Tenerife, Madrid and London airports.
How long is the flight to Moya Airport?
Which airport you depart from determines how much of the in-flight entertainment you'll get to see. From Santa Cruz de Tenerife to Moya, the average flight time is 32 minutes. From Madrid it's around 2 hours and 53 minutes, and from London it's 4 hours and 29 minutes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of restricted items differs between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, pocket knives, fireworks and fuel. Sports equipment like baseball bats, and objects that could harm passengers, such as firearms and ammunition, aren't all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your number one priority when deciding what to wear on board. Loose, breathable clothing is a smart option, as are flat, closed-toe shoes.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ation, so do some gentle leg and foot exercises in your seat and consider wearing compression socks or tights.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Moya?
As savvy travellers know, the secret is to be prepared before you reach the security gate.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to Moya in next to no time. Follow these helpful tips and get your trip off to a terrific start:

  • Security personnel first need to see that you have a valid ID and matching boarding pass before anything else. Have them in your hand, ready for inspection.
  • Next up, both you and your hand luggage will be X-rayed. To speed things up, remove anything that might set the alarms off. Items such as your jacket, belt and earphones need to go through the machine.
  • Your electronic devices like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ray to be scanned. Don't worry, you'll be back online in no time.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as toothpaste or perfume,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• There's a good chance you'll be asked to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a clever id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p objects in your carry-on bagg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ked luggage.
